Common Oak Tree Pruning Jobs
Oak Tree Pruning Services - Proper pruning encourages healthy growth and maintains the tree's shape.
Tree thinning - Removing select branches reduces weight and improves air circulation within the canopy.
Deadwood removal - Eliminating dead or diseased branches helps prevent decay and pest infestations.
Structural pruning - Correcting weak branch attachments enhances stability and reduces risk of limb failure.
Crown reduction - Reducing the height or spread of an oak tree preserves space and enhances safety.
Storm damage cleanup - Clearing broken or damaged branches minimizes hazards after severe weather events.
Oak Tree Pruning Questions
Why is pruning an oak tree important? Proper pruning helps maintain the tree’s health, promotes growth, and prevents safety hazards caused by dead or overgrown branches.
When is the best time to prune an oak tree? The ideal time to prune oak trees is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
What types of pruning are recommended for oak trees? Crown thinning, crown raising, and deadwood removal are common pruning techniques for oak trees.
How can improper pruning affect an oak tree? Incorrect pruning can lead to weak growth, increased risk of disease, and structural issues over time.
